CBRL Hedge Fund Activity: Q3 2025 in Review

249 of the 7,619 institutional investors tracked by Wall St. Rank reported a position in Cracker Barrel (CBRL) for Q3 2025, worth a combined $1.03B — down 34% from $1.56B a quarter earlier.

Sellers outnumbered buyers: 65 funds closed out of CBRL and 44 opened new positions — a net loss of 21 holders — while 79 trimmed existing stakes and 77 added.

The largest buyer was Franklin Resources, adding an estimated $53.4M. The largest seller was EARNEST Partners, exiting entirely with an estimated $74.5M sold.
